Web8 de set. de 2024 · In conclusion, we found that the incidence of developing postoperative pneumonia among open heart surgery patients in our institute between 2014 and 2024 was 2.5%, indicating a high-quality level of surgical technique and proper infection control. Haemophilus influenzae represent the most common cause in our observations. Web23 de dez. de 2024 · Open heart surgery is a surgical procedure where the chest is cut open to operate on the heart. It is used to correct several types of heart problems such as birth defects of the heart, heart valve diseases and coronary artery disease. Web6 de dez. de 2024 · Your wound may open wide enough to see internal organs or tissues. You also may have tissues bulging out of the wound. If this happens, cover the area with a moist sterile bandage and call 911. To prevent shock, lie down with your legs elevated 8 to 12 inches. Prevention Inspect your incision daily during wound care. Minimally invasive heart surgery, which uses smaller incisions in the chest. Minimally invasive heart surgery may involve a shorter hospital stay, quicker recovery and less pain than open-heart surgery.

Web12 de out. de 2016 · Bypass Surgery. Coronary bypass surgery is performed to treat blockages in heart arteries. It is the most common open heart surgery. In this operation arteries and/or veins are used to bypass the blockage and improve the blood supply to the heart. The arteries can be taken either from inside the chest wall, or the arm. It is a major operation during which the surgeon will open the chest to access the … WebSwelling or knot-like lump at the top of your chest incision. This often goes away in six to eight weeks. Aches between your shoulder blades, over the ribs, in the back of the neck, chest or leg incision. This may last for many weeks and lessen with time. Tingling or numbness in your elbow or fingers.
